1988
The Desert Miracle
That was the name given to Emirates
Golf Club, when it became the
first championship all-grass golf
course in the golf region, way
back in 1988.
The
brainchild of His Highness General
Sheikh Mohamed bin Rashid Al
Maktoum, the Club was built
as an attraction to the growing
corporate sector and the then
burgeoning tourist industry.
Within a month of opening the
most important regional golf
tournament - the Pan-Arab -
was taking place on the newly
named Majlis course.
Designed
by Florida-based course architect
Karl Litten, the original 18
holes were built in and around
the dunes of a beautiful site
on the edge of the city of Dubai,
donated by Sheikh Mohamed, on
whose instructions, the desert
flora was maintained, as it
is to this day, in its natural
state.
1989
The
club's international recognition
was confirmed in 1989 with the
Club's first European Tour event
- the Dubai Desert Classic.
Fourteen years later the tournament
reaches hundreds of millions
of TV screens around the world
every year, and most of the
world's top players, including
Tiger Woods and Ernie Els, have
taken part in what is now one
of the European PGA Tour's top
events.
1995
In
1995 the club was voted the
Favourite of the Year by the
players of the European Tour,
and in 1996 the second eighteen
holes - the Wadi Course - were
completed, bringing Emirates
Golf Club to its current 36-holes.
2003
Today,
Emirates Golf Club maintains
its position as the leading
golf club in the region and
continues to meet international
standards in every aspect of
its operation.
As
the original "desert course"
in the Middle East, the Majlis
remains in many peoples' minds
a miracle - The Desert Miracle.
